This component edits a single XML file as instructed by clients via
|
||||
Report sessions. It is designed to allow insertion and removal of XML
|
||||
nodes without revealing the content the file being edited.
|
||||
|
||||
The three edit actions are _add_, _remove_, and toggle, all operate over XML
|
||||
nodes under the parent node in the file being edited. The content of
|
||||
edits are verified for corrent syntax and XML node type and _name_
|
||||
attribute is used to prevent the same node from being inserted
|
||||
twice and to find nodes to remove or toggle.
|
||||
|
||||
Add action
|
||||
----------
|
||||
! <add>
|
||||
! <... name="...">
|
||||
! ...
|
||||
! </...>
|
||||
! </add>
|
||||
|
||||
Remove action
|
||||
-------------
|
||||
! <remove>
|
||||
! <... name="..."/>
|
||||
! </remove>
|
||||
|
||||
Toggle action
|
||||
-------------
|
||||
! <toggle>
|
||||
! <... name="...">
|
||||
! ...
|
||||
! </...>
|
||||
! </toggle>

This component is a simple terminal frontend to _xml_editor_.
|
||||
|
||||
The _add_ command opens and reads a file path passed as an agument
|
||||
and submits it to _xml_editor_ for inclusion into the file being
|
||||
edited.
|
||||
|
||||
The _del_ command does the same, but submits a _remove_ edit action
|
||||
and _xml_editor_ will remove nodes from the file being edited using
|
||||
the XML node type and _name_ attribute.
|
||||
|
||||
See _run/xml_term_edit.run_ for an example.
